Transaction 3ab401878cb221f96734234c3e3488e9d565e73fcc16071db13cc2800edcce3e
2 Input
2 Outputs
- 3ab401878cb221f96734234c3e3488e9d565e73fcc16071db13cc2800edcce3e:0
- 3ab401878cb221f96734234c3e3488e9d565e73fcc16071db13cc2800edcce3e:1
value 201000
address 1KcUUDDPLmu6CSGcgRifM168u3HE7Ysfb
value 463960000
address 1HfeHu3a9UcS6Z2UGfoWdJttdUkuRRYMoY